Aussiejed of Eureka Miniatures writes:

As previously announced, Alan Marsh has made "Sampler" 28mm Dark Age figures for us. Here are some pictures of them as painted by Kosta Heristanidis. More images will follow when we have chance to photograph the rest.

28mm Dark Ages Sampler

We have mounted and dismounted versions of the same figure, as well as a variety of archers. Our intention is to monitor their sales closely, and those that are most popular will be expanded.

28mm Dark Ages Sampler

So far, through our shop, it looks as though we will have to make more of all of them, as all purchasers so far have bought equal numbers of all of them. Come and see us at Historicon and tell us which are your favorites.
